Свързани въпроси 'vala'
Vala (C#-подобен език) се компилира до C?
Аз съм C# разработчик, който случайно се натъкна на нов език за програмиране за Linux, наречен vala. Има почти същия синтаксис като C#, което е страхотно. Никога не съм бил голям фен на Mono. Това позволява на програмистите да пишат GTK+ приложения...
4869 изгледи
schedule
19.09.2022
Vala двоичен файл за структуриране като използван c fread
Опитвам се да конвертирам директно от двоичен файл в структура. Мога да го направя на c, но не знам как да го направя на vala. Поставям примерите за код на C и Vala по-долу.
struct Header
{
char name[30]; // PK2 internal name
uint32_t...
79 изгледи
schedule
18.09.2022
Асинхронна функция във Vala - Добив и обратно извикване
Разработвам проект, написан на Vala и GTK +, трябва да внедря асинхронна функция, затова реших да направя пример за тест ... и по някаква причина получавам следната грешка:
async.vala:31.3-31.20: грешка: Достъпът до async обратно извикване...
1435 изгледи
schedule
24.09.2022
vala Posix.lstat() грешка
Имам тази част от кода:
using Posix;
int fuseguifs_getattr(string path, Posix.Stat *stbuf)
{
int res;
res = Posix.lstat(path, stbuf);
if (res == -1)
return -Posix.errno;
return 0;
}
static int main(string [] args)
{...
828 изгледи
schedule
17.11.2022
Работи ли foreach на Iterator?
using Gee;
int main (string[] args) {
ArrayList<string> list = new ArrayList<string>();
list.add ("a");
list.add ("b");
list.add ("c");
foreach (var s in list.filter (s => s > "a"))...
388 изгледи
schedule
20.10.2022
Emacs и vala-mode
Използвам vala-mode за редактиране на Vala код в Emacs. Искам обаче да променя две неща във vala-mode:
Искам да направя отстъп с 4 интервала вместо с 2 интервала (което е моят Emacs по подразбиране). Искам да активирам автоматичното довършване...
702 изгледи
schedule
29.11.2023
Защо webkit-1.0 и gtk+-3.0 имат повече от 900 еднакви символа в .vapi файлове
Както се казва в заглавието, проблемът ми е, че се опитвам да използвам и gtk 3, и webkit 1.
Следвам този пример https://live.gnome.org/Vala/WebKitSample
с изключение на това, че използвам gtk 3 вместо 2.
Използвам valac 0.16.0
Сега...
1544 изгледи
schedule
07.12.2023
[genie/vala]: Как да сортирам с помощта на персонализиран компаратор?
Джин! как да сортирате масив (или списък) от низове в низходящ ред и във възходящ лексикографски ред за низове с еднаква дължина.
моите данни са
datas : array of string = {
"cold", "z", "bpples", "pallalala", "apples", "xccv"
}
357 изгледи
schedule
24.11.2023
Големи цели числа и произволни/многопрецизни плаващи числа за Vala
Има ли начин да се използват големи цели числа или произволни типове точност във vala?
352 изгледи
schedule
03.03.2024
Изграждане на най-новите версии на Vala (направете проверка неуспешна и valac не може да намери споделена библиотека)
Изтеглих последните две най-нови версии на VALA ( v0.17.0 и 0.16.0 ) и се опитах да изградя на моята машина за разработка (Ubuntu 10.0.4 с gcc 4.4.3).
Когато създадох версия 0.17.0 , забелязах, че някои грешки мигат на екрана. Пускам make...
1426 изгледи
schedule
19.03.2024
Как да съхранявате OAuth идентификационни данни с Gnome Keyring
Опитвам се да създам просто приложение за Twitter на Vala/Gtk и успях да изпратя туитове; потребителят обаче трябва да се удостоверява всеки път, което включва отиване на URL адрес, щракване, за да се даде на моето приложение разрешение за...
619 изгледи
schedule
18.04.2024
.desktop файлове с персонализирани икони
Създадох приложение и персонализирана икона за него. Успешно инсталирах и т.н. и когато добавя път към пътя на иконата във файла .dekstop по следния начин:
Icon=/usr/share/icons/hicolor/64x64/resize.svg
работи добре, но с Icon=resize не...
874 изгледи
schedule
26.05.2024